Synopsis for "Infinite Destinies, Part Five"
In Alfheim, Highelf Everdrop is the caretaker of Qaoyak Tree. As he's tending to his duties, he is attacked by some sort of shadowy creature and replaced. Elsewhere, the Light Elves are preparing for the celebration commemorating the end of the War of the Realms. Thor, the other Asgardians, and the League of Realms arrive to attend the celebration. During the feast, Everdrop presents them with a gift of plants, but it was a trap. The buds knock everyone else out, but the plant presented to Thor, attaches something to his face, causing him to have hallucinations and nightmares. "Everdrop" reveals himself to really be Valg, an entity from another dimension that feeds to fear and anguish. Valg uses this to alter Thor's past, creating a variant named Thor Bor-Kin. A Thor that killed his Loki and went on to kill everything. Valg summons Thor Bor-Kin to the present, where he battles Thor. Thor, being the All-Father, uses his power to send this Thor back in time to before Valg corrupted him so that he could change his own past. As the others start to wake, Valg makes his escape.
